Let the first integer be x then, the second number will be x+1 third will be x+2 fourth will be x+3, since the four integers are consecutive..... now, the sum of four integers is 9 less than 5times the first integer... i.e. sum of integers = 5 times of first - 9 => x + (x+1) + (x+2) + (x+3) = 5(x) - 9 => 4(x) + 6 = 5(x) - 9 on solving, it gives x = 15 so the integers are 15, 16, 17 and 18 hope its clear..:)

x + (x + 1) + (x + 2) + (x + 3) = 2
4x + 6 = 2
4x = - 4
x = - 1
- 1 is smallest integer.
